Output 3bd27166b25215a398cee54e4139e448447288bec134ab8f4d52e7acdaf59117:0

value
66496991
script pubkey
OP_0 OP_PUSHBYTES_20 74d86b607de15f8a283e5275cd6d810ae9690c3b
address
bc1qwnvxkcrau90c52p72f6u6mvppt5kjrpmdmpmfl
transaction
3bd27166b25215a398cee54e4139e448447288bec134ab8f4d52e7acdaf59117
confirmations
263763
spent
true